Job Description

Overview

The audiology assistant's primary role is to aid the audiology department in providing essential patient care. They perform amplification repairs and minor troubleshooting, stocking and ordering equipment, fielding patient phone calls and messages, as well as additional tasks to assist in patient care. These duties will take place at all assigned satellite locations


Responsibilities

Support functions including both direct and indirect patient care. Support functions including both direct and indirect patient care.

Perform routine daily clinic functions such as stocking supplies, turning on and off equipment, equipment biologic checks/ troubleshooting and ensuring all patient care areas have the needed items for service.

Assisting audiologists in all operations related to all hearing devices such as hearing aids (HA), bone conduction hearing devices (BCHD), ear molds (EM), cochlear implants (CI), assistive listening devices (ALD) systems, etc.

Tracking amplification inventory, repairs, loaners. Ensure that all incoming and outgoing mail tracking numbers are recorded.

Regularly correspond with manufacturers regarding patient requests and departmental needs.

Perform troubleshooting/repairs, direct patient contact in the form of troubleshooting and education, enter and quote charges appropriately, and document in patient's chart.

Order supplies and devices, check-in equipment, receive packages, perform budget, spreadsheets maintenance, payment request completion, and accounts payable reconciliation.

Completes all required training related to hearing devices. Attends any assigned staff meetings and product informational meetings to stay up to date on new technology and practice.

Additional miscellaneous duties and responsibilities, as assigned by management and audiology team lead.
